Council Tax Bill Charges by Band
The data is sourced from South Norfolk Council.
Following are details about tax rates for eight house tax bands set by local authority/council South Norfolk. Check your property tax band and map in below table to find your house council tax rates.
- Authority Name
South Norfolk, Norfolk
- Type
Shire Districts
- Anual Rate Change
3.12%
Tax band | Rate for year 2021/22 | Rate for year 2022/23 | Percentage change |
---|---|---|---|
A | £1,274 | £1,313 | 3.12% |
B | £1,486 | £1,532 | 3.12% |
C | £1,699 | £1,751 | 3.12% |
D | £1,911 | £1,970 | 3.12% |
E | £2,336 | £2,408 | 3.12% |
F | £2,760 | £2,846 | 3.12% |
G | £3,185 | £3,283 | 3.12% |
H | £3,822 | £3,940 | 3.12% |
